
As usual, I drew another picture, which is still related to the railway
In the picture, on the left is China's first generation of main line diesel locomotive named DF1 (东风1/东风3)and the right is China's largest and most technologically mature steam locomotive called QJ,(前进型蒸汽机车)<In fact, QJ and DF is Chinese Pinyin, a kind of abbreviation similar to English phonetic symbols,In Chinese, QJ stands for advance, enterprising and progress,Similarly, DF comes from a famous saying once popular in China:“东风压倒西风”Please forgive me for using Chinese, because the time background and deep meaning behind this sentence are too complex for me to translate accurately>These two locomotives used to be the first generation main force of Chinese Railways,DF1 is the product of imitating ТЭ3 diesel locomotive of former Soviet Union,QJ type is made in China,After witnessing the development of China for more than 30 years, they retired in the 1990s and gradually ended their service career,In fact, China once sold 5 QJ to Railroad Development Corporation(I haven't heard of this company at all) for dynamic preservation and sightseeing,In 2006, after arriving in the United States, the locomotives were put into service on the Iowa Interstate Railroad.Fourteen years later, I don't know if these locomotives are still in service in IAIS.
